# Het opzetten van een staging omgeving voor testdoeleinden
Het opzetten van een staging omgeving voor testdoeleinden is een essentieel onderdeel van het ontwikkelen en optimaliseren van websites. Het stelt je in staat om veranderingen en updates door te voeren op een aparte omgeving, voordat deze live gaan. Hierdoor minimaliseer je het risico op fouten en verstoringen op de live website. In dit artikel deel ik mijn ervaring en tips voor het succesvol opzetten van een staging omgeving.
## Stappenplan voor het opzetten van een staging omgeving
### 1. Kies een geschikt hostingplatform
Het eerste wat je moet doen bij het opzetten van een staging omgeving is het kiezen van een geschikt hostingplatform. Zorg ervoor dat het hostingplatform de mogelijkheid biedt om meerdere omgevingen te creëren en te beheren. Populaire hostingplatforms zoals SiteGround, Bluehost en Kinsta bieden vaak deze functionaliteit.
### 2. Maak een kopie van je live website
Voordat je wijzigingen gaat testen, is het belangrijk om een exacte kopie van je live website te maken en deze naar de staging omgeving te verplaatsen. Dit kan vaak eenvoudig worden gedaan met behulp van tools zoals Duplicator of de migratietool van je hostingprovider.
### 3. Test de functionaliteit en compatibiliteit
Zodra je staging omgeving is opgezet, is het tijd om de functionaliteit en compatibiliteit van je website te testen. Controleer of alle pagina’s correct worden weergegeven, of formulieren naar behoren werken en of eventuele plugins of thema’s goed functioneren in de nieuwe omgeving.
### 4. Voer uitgebreide tests uit
Na het controleren van de basisfunctionaliteit, is het raadzaam om uitgebreide tests uit te voeren. Denk hierbij aan het testen van verschillende browsers, apparaten en schermformaten. Zorg ervoor dat alle elementen van de website consistent en goed functioneren op alle platformen.
### 5. Implementeer feedback en optimaliseer
Op basis van de testresultaten kun je feedback verzamelen en eventuele verbeteringen doorvoeren. Denk hierbij aan het optimaliseren van laadtijden, het verbeteren van de gebruikerservaring en het oplossen van eventuele bugs of fouten.
## Voordelen van het gebruik van een staging omgeving
– **Risicovermindering:** Door wijzigingen eerst te testen in een aparte omgeving, minimaliseer je het risico op fouten en verstoringen op de live website.
– **Efficiëntie:** Het werken in een staging omgeving stelt je in staat om sneller en efficiënter wijzigingen door te voeren, zonder dat dit direct invloed heeft op de live website.
– **Kwaliteitscontrole:** Door uitgebreide tests uit te voeren in de staging omgeving, zorg je voor een betere kwaliteitscontrole van de website voordat deze live gaat.
## Conclusie
Het opzetten van een staging omgeving voor testdoeleinden is een waardevolle stap in het ontwikkelproces van een website. Het stelt je in staat om wijzigingen veilig en efficiënt door te voeren, zonder dat dit direct impact heeft op de live website. Door het volgen van bovenstaande stappen en het uitvoeren van uitgebreide tests, kun je ervoor zorgen dat je website optimaal presteert en gebruikers een optimale ervaring biedt.